MySQL是最受歡迎的開源關系型數據庫管理系統之一,經常被用于存儲和管理Web應用程序中的數據。其中的除法運算在處理數據時發揮了很大的作用。在MySQL中,我們可以使用除法來計算兩個數的商,并且還可以控制小數點后的位數。
下面我們來看一個具體的例子。假設我們有一個表格,其中包含兩個字段:
CREATE TABLE products ( id INT AUTO_INCREMENT PRIMARY KEY, price DECIMAL(8,2) NOT NULL, quantity INT NOT NULL );
在這個例子中,我們使用了DECIMAL類型的price字段,它可以存儲最多8位數字,其中2位是小數位數。quantity字段則是一個普通的整數類型,表示商品的數量。
現在假設我們想要計算每個商品的平均價格。我們可以使用下面的語句:
SELECT AVG(price) FROM products;
這個語句會返回所有商品價格的平均值。不過,結果只會保留兩位小數。如果我們想要調整結果中小數的位數,可以使用MySQL內置的函數ROUND來進行四舍五入。例如,我們想要將小數位數調整到四位:
SELECT ROUND(AVG(price), 4) FROM products;
這個語句會返回平均價格,小數位數為四位。
總的來說,MySQL中的除法運算可以幫助我們計算數字之間的比率和平均值,并且還可以控制小數的位數。這種功能在Web應用程序開發中非常有用,可以幫助我們管理和分析數據,從而做出更好的決策。